**Segments**
- **Type:** The global fuel additive market can be segmented based on type into deposit control additives, cetane improvers, lubricity improvers, cold flow improvers, stability improvers, corrosion inhibitors, octane improvers, biodiesel additives, and others. Deposit control additives are used to prevent the build-up of deposits in engines and fuel systems, ensuring smooth operation. Cetane improvers help in enhancing the cetane number of diesel fuels, improving combustion efficiency. Lubricity improvers reduce friction between moving parts in engines, leading to improved performance and longevity. Cold flow improvers prevent the formation of wax crystals in cold temperatures, maintaining fuel flow properties. Stability improvers extend the shelf life of fuels by preventing oxidation and degradation. Corrosion inhibitors protect metal components from corrosion caused by fuel. Octane improvers boost the octane rating of gasoline, improving engine performance. Biodiesel additives are specifically designed for biodiesel blends to enhance their properties and performance.
- **Application:** The market can also be segmented based on application into gasoline, diesel, aviation fuel, and others. Gasoline additives are primarily used to enhance fuel performance, mitigate engine knocking, and improve fuel efficiency. Diesel additives help in improving cetane number, lubricity, and stability of diesel fuels, leading to better engine performance and reduced emissions. Aviation fuel additives are vital for maintaining the quality and integrity of aviation fuels, ensuring safety and efficiency in aircraft operations.
- **End-User:** In terms of end-user, the market can be segmented into automotive, aerospace, marine, industrial, and others. The automotive sector is a significant consumer of fuel additives, where these products are utilized to optimize vehicle performance and meet regulatory standards. Aerospace applications require specialized fuel additives to ensure the safety and efficiency of aircraft operations. The marine industry utilizes fuel additives to enhance fuel quality, reduce emissions, and improve engine reliability. Industrial end-users rely on fuel additives to maintain operational efficiency and comply with environmental regulations.
